<p><a href="http://thetennistimes.com/andy-murray-uk-player-profile/" target="_self">Andy Murray</a> has entered the debate over the value of the tennis world rankings by questioning the Williams sisters&#8217; interest in tournaments outside the grand slams.</p>
<p>The rise of Russian Dinara Safina to No 1 has raised the question of whether it is justifiable for a player without a grand slam title to be on top. <a href="http://thetennistimes.com/serena-williams-usa-player-profile/" target="_self">Serena Williams</a> has won three of the last four grand slam women&#8217;s singles titles, however she only stands at No. 2 in the WTA Tour standings. Men&#8217;s world No. 2 Murray, who has also still yet to win one of the four top tournaments in tennis, believes there would be little merit in raising the points on offer at the Australian Open, French Open, Wimbledon and US Open just to ensure the winners of those events have a better chance of topping the rankings.</p>
<p>Murray understands why the issue is being discussed, and why there are varying views, but he is convinced the ranking systems as they stand have plenty of merit.</p>
<p>The Scot said:</p>
<blockquote><p>&#8220;Do you not agree that it&#8217;s important for the top players like Serena to turn up at the other big events? &#8220;Tennis (has) an 11-month calendar. If you have ranking points which are too small for Serena to turn up at some of the smaller events, then all of a sudden the whole calendar is completely pointless and she can turn up &#8212; which is probably what she wants to do &#8212; at the four slams and play, and then not play for the rest of the year. And I think you have to be rewarded for consistency, and her consistency in slams is great, but in the other tournaments I don&#8217;t think it is.&#8221;</p></blockquote>
